The process of hydrolysis may be represented by which of the following?


  1. H + Cl − + Na + OH − → Na + + Cl − + H 2 O
  2. C 12 H 22 O 11 + H 2 O → 2C 6 H 12 O 6
  3. alanine + glycine → alanylglycine + H 2 O
  4. glucose → glycogenesis → glycogen

 B: Hydrolysis refers to using a water molecule to split a larger molecule in smaller ones. Here a disaccharide is being split into two monosaccharide molecules.
